A PAIR OF STRAW-GLAZED POTTERY FIGURES OF HORSES, each modelled standing foursquare on a rectangular base and looking straight ahead with head slightly lowered, the saddle placed over a shaped blanket and draped with a knotted saddle cloth, all under a rich pale yellow glaze (one with part of tail and blanket missing, both with ears chipped), Sui early Tang Dynasty
24cm. high (2)
